Abstract
q-W algebras were introduced in the mid 90th as q-analogues of W-algebras and as hypothetical symmetry algebras for massive two-dimensional quantum field theories. The structure of these algebras is still poorly understood.In this talk I shall consider finitely generated versions of q-W algebras. I shall show that q-W algebras belong to the class of the so-called Mickelsson algebras. They can be described in terms of certain conceptual analogues of projection operators introduced independently by Zhelobenko and by Asherova, Smirnov and Tolstoy in the course of the study of singular vectors in highest weight representations of complex semi-simple Lie algebras. This phenomenon does not take place for the usual W-algebras.
